HB 263 allow Hunting with Semi automatic Rifles in PA Rep Saccone 2015-2016
Well after many twist and turns over coming opposition by amending to other bills, along with several sessions of efforts to seek passage.... we (all of us) got the legislators to remove the prohibition on the use of semi-auto firearms for hunting in PA and signed into law by Governor Wolf
Signed in House, Oct.*27,*2016
Signed in Senate, Nov.*9,*2016
Presented to the Governor, Nov.*14,*2016
Approved by the Governor, Nov.*21,*2016
Act No. 168 of 2016
Nov 21, 2016 **** Mission Accomplished!

MEMORANDUM
Posted:
January 26, 2015 02:32 PM
From:
Representative Rick Saccone
To:
All House members
Subject:
Hunting with Semiautomatic Rifles, former HB 2333
In the near future I plan on introducing legislation that would amend Title 34 section 2308 Unlawful Devices and Methods to allow hunting with semi-automatic rifles in Pennsylvania. More specifically it would allow hunting with semi-automatic center fire rifles limited to a five shell capacity and .22 caliber semi-automatic rim fire rifles with a built in capacity limit.
Currently, we are one of two states forbidding such hunting. Even Hawaii, California and New York allow hunting with semiautomatic rifles.
Pennsylvania hunters have proven for decades that they are trustworthy, responsible and ethical stewards of Pennsylvania’s hunting/sporting heritage.
It is time Pennsylvania joins the rest of America in allowing hunting in this regard.
Thank you in advance for your consideration.
